首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在"WHERE column =?"中,问号在MySQL中的意义是什么?

在MySQL中,问号(?)是一个占位符,用于表示在SQL查询中的变量值。在"WHERE column =?"这个例子中,问号表示要在WHERE子句中筛选的特定值。这种占位符的用法可以防止SQL注入攻击,并允许在查询中使用动态值。

例如,如果要查询名为"users"的表中,其中"age"列等于30的所有记录,可以使用以下查询:

代码语言:txt
复制
SELECT * FROM users WHERE age = ?;

在实际执行查询时,会将问号替换为实际的值,例如:

代码语言:txt
复制
SELECT * FROM users WHERE age = 30;

这种占位符的用法在许多编程语言和数据库连接库中都有支持,例如Python的MySQL Connector库、Java的JDBC库等。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

4分9秒

07-Servlet-2/08-尚硅谷-Servlet-斜杠在web中的不同意义

34分48秒

104-MySQL目录结构与表在文件系统中的表示

10分3秒

65-IOC容器在Spring中的实现

2分35秒

146_尚硅谷_MySQL基础_演示delete和truncate在事务中的区别

2分35秒

146_尚硅谷_MySQL基础_演示delete和truncate在事务中的区别.avi

5分12秒

Python MySQL数据库开发 3 在Mac系统中安装MySQL 学习猿地

10分28秒

JavaSE进阶-035-接口在开发中的作用

7分46秒

JavaSE进阶-037-接口在开发中的作用

32分47秒

JavaSE进阶-038-接口在开发中的作用

5分55秒

JavaSE进阶-034-接口在开发中的作用

24分57秒

JavaSE进阶-036-接口在开发中的作用

5分36秒

05.在ViewPager的ListView中播放视频.avi

领券